Chef, owner, and visionary Justin Cucci and his Edible Beats restaurant group have taken the Mile High food scene by storm – first opening Root Down in an old gas station, next Linger in a former mortuary, and most recently Ophelia’s Electric Soapbox in a bygone brothel. Since the eclectic eatery opened its doors last spring, it has become one of the city’s hottest night spots, brunch haunts, and so much more.
